What is an HDU4 Hold Down Bolt?


The HDU4 hold down bolt is specifically designed to anchor wooden structures to their foundation, providing resistance against lateral forces such as wind and seismic activity. It is commonly utilized to secure wall frames to sill plates or foundation walls in wood-framed constructions. The HDU series, including HDU4, is known for its reliability and robust performance, making it a preferred choice among engineers and builders.

Importance of Proper Sizing


Choosing the correct size of the HDU4 hold down bolt is critical for structural integrity. An undersized bolt may not handle the forces effectively, leading to potential structural failure, while oversized bolts can complicate installation and increase costs. Here are the critical factors to consider


1. Building Codes and Regulations Local building codes often dictate specific requirements for hold down bolts in terms of size and spacing. It is crucial to consult these guidelines to ensure compliance and safety.


2. Structural Analysis A thorough analysis of the loads expected on the structure will help determine the appropriate size. This includes considering factors such as wind loads, seismic activity, and other environmental influences.


3. Type of Materials Used Different materials have varying strength characteristics. The type of wood or composite materials used in construction can impact the size and number of bolts needed to achieve optimal stability.


4. Installation Environment The conditions in which the bolt will be installed play a significant role in sizing. For instance, areas prone to high winds or seismic activity may require larger or more numerous hold down bolts.
